Travelling from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port (FOR): What you need to know
Start your travel planning by considering where you'll board your flight from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port (FOR). Jorge Newbery Airport (AEP) and Ministro Pistarini Airport (EZE) are the two main airports in Buenos Aires.
Jump on a direct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port flight and you'll be in the air for an average of 5 hours 30 minutes.
Pinto Martins Airport is located in Fortaleza. The city's timezone is UTC-3 — the same as Buenos Aires.

Airports in Buenos Aires
Jorge Newbery Airport (AEP)
You can hop on a direct flight from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port (FOR) leaving from Jorge Newbery Airport (AEP).
When departing from AEP, you can catch a direct flight from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port with Gol.
Most passengers prefer to fly with Gol from AEP to FOR.
Travelling from central Buenos Aires to AEP takes about 40 minutes on public transport. If you ride-share, drive or take a cab, you'll cover the 14 kilometres in 20 minutes or so, depending on traffic.

Ministro Pistarini Airport (EZE)
Consider starting your trip from Ministro Pistarini Airport (EZE). You can book a direct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port (FOR) plane ticket from this popular hub.
You can board a direct flight from Buenos Aires to FOR with Gol. This is one of the top airlines operating this route out of EZE.
Gol is the most popular choice for passengers flying from EZE to FOR.
If you're looking for a consistently punctual carrier, go with Gol. It boasts an on-time performance of 85.71% for flights between Ministro Pistarini Airport and Pinto Martins Airport.
You can arrive at EZE from the centre of Buenos Aires in about 35 minutes by car (depending on traffic conditions). The journey by public transport will take roughly 2 hours 10 minutes to cover the 32 kilometres or so.

Getting from Pinto Martins Airport (FOR) to central Fortaleza
The centre of Fortaleza is about 5 kilometres from Pinto Martins Airport. Journey times by cab or car hire will vary depending on time of day, so do some research before you go.
It takes around 50 minutes when travelling by public transport.

The best time to fly from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port (FOR)
July is the busiest month for flights from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port (FOR). Visit Fortaleza in April if you'd rather avoid peak season.
Lock in a Buenos Aires to FOR plane ticket departing in October if you want to experience the city during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ures in Fortaleza to range from 24ºC (75ºF) to 32ºC (90ºF).
For c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from Buenos Aires to Pinto Martins Airport in July when temperatures are between 23ºC (73ºF) and 31ºC (88ºF).
